Only 5 homes stand on Pebble Beach's famous 18th hole. See one that just set the $45 million record

A home on the world-famous 18th hole of the Pebble Beach Golf Links has set the record for the highest residential real estate sale in Monterey County at $45 million, according to Coldwell Banker.

The 10,500-square-foot home on 1.76 acres of meticulously maintained property was owned by John J. Moores, according to public records. Moores, a Texas millionaire, is the former owner of the San Diego Padres. He bought the property in 1994 for $7 million, according to public records.

The so-called “Masterpiece on 18” at 1544 Cypress Drive was closed on Monday. There are very few houses directly on the legendary 18th hole, where residents can also enjoy a breathtaking view of the Pacific Ocean.

One of the famous cypresses on the fairway of the 18th hole stands right next to the rear terrace of the house and is beautifully framed from the inside by a glass wall.

“We are pleased to have been able to organize a successful discreet marketing and sale of our client's property, one of only five prestigious homes on the 18th hole of this iconic golf course,” Tim Allen, a broker with Tim Allen Properties, which is affiliated with Coldwell Banker Realty, said in a statement.

“The lure of the unparalleled amenities and spectacular ocean views that await the new owners has made this closing an all-time high for a home sale in Monterey County,” he added. “We extend our warmest wishes to the new owners as they enjoy their stunning modern home in this beautiful location.”

The name of the new owner was not disclosed.

The modern five-bedroom, ten-bathroom home was designed by architect Robert Griffin.

Previously, the most expensive home sale in the county was a $40 million deal in 2022 for a historic home called “Seaward” that sits above the sea. Brad Pitt owns this residence in Carmel Highlands.
